    There were three Presidents in the year 1881. The first was Rutherford B. Hayes. He was the 19th President of the United States, and he took office on March 4, 1877 and left office on March 4, 1881. He was then followed by James A. Garfield, who was the 20th President, taking office on March 4, 1881 but assassinated on July 2, 1881.
